Description: This paper
presents a PSCAD/EMTDC model of PV solar panels, the grid
connected three phase voltage sourced inverter (VSI) and its
controller system. The VSI control is implemented with current
control loops. A maximum power point tracking (MPPT)
algorithm is implemented to get the maximum output power for
any given solar irradiation and temperature. This is integrated
with the inverter control in such a way that the requirement of
DC-DC converter is eliminated to harvest the maximum power.
The inverter model also maintains near unity power factor
regardless of the level of power output and maintains an
acceptable level of current harmonics. Finally, the developed
model is validated with the output of a commercially used PV
module. Platform: |

Description: simulation and hardware implementation
of incremental conductance (IncCond) maximum
power point tracking (MPPT) used in solar array power systems
with direct control method. The main difference of the proposed
system to existing MPPT systems includes elimination of the
proportional–integral control loop and investigation of the effect of
simplifying the control circuit. Contributions are made in several
aspects of the whole system, including converter design, system
simulation, controller programming, and experimental setup. The
resultant system is capable of tracking MPPs accurately and
rapidly without steady-state oscillation, and also, its dynamic performance
is satisfactory. The IncCond algorithm is used to track
MPPs because it performs precise control under rapidly changing
atmospheric conditions. MATLAB and Simulink were employed
for simulation studies, and Code Composer Studio v3.1 was used
to program a TMS320F2812 digital signal processor. The p Platform: |
